diff options
| author | shedaniel <daniel@shedaniel.me> | 2023-05-30 01:25:03 +0800 |
|---|---|---|
| committer | shedaniel <daniel@shedaniel.me> | 2023-05-30 01:25:03 +0800 |
| commit | 085056774ab43cf3287286911adf6bb6dbecb643 (patch) | |
| tree | a5741bd7f36f4241ea2ae9a5aff9fb11c9aba14a | |
| parent | 2b7553564ce617cd2ac8b7c8e1ff36f818d8279a (diff) | |
| parent | d0f07b4adfbd6a8e7424b821cda0143eba401ae9 (diff) | |
| download | RoughlyEnoughItems-085056774ab43cf3287286911adf6bb6dbecb643.tar.gz RoughlyEnoughItems-085056774ab43cf3287286911adf6bb6dbecb643.tar.bz2 RoughlyEnoughItems-085056774ab43cf3287286911adf6bb6dbecb643.zip | |
Merge remote-tracking branch 'shedaniel/10.x-1.19.3' into 11.x-1.19.4
| -rw-r--r-- | runtime/src/main/java/me/shedaniel/rei/impl/client/util/ThreadCreator.java | 1 |
1 files changed, 1 insertions, 0 deletions
diff --git a/runtime/src/main/java/me/shedaniel/rei/impl/client/util/ThreadCreator.java b/runtime/src/main/java/me/shedaniel/rei/impl/client/util/ThreadCreator.java index b55c0dab6..d49b7c2cd 100644 --- a/runtime/src/main/java/me/shedaniel/rei/impl/client/util/ThreadCreator.java +++ b/runtime/src/main/java/me/shedaniel/rei/impl/client/util/ThreadCreator.java @@ -55,6 +55,7 @@ public final class ThreadCreator { return new ForkJoinPool(poolSize, pool -> { ForkJoinWorkerThread worker = ForkJoinPool.defaultForkJoinWorkerThreadFactory.newThread(pool); worker.setName(group().getName() + "-" + worker.getPoolIndex()); + worker.setContextClassLoader(getClass().getClassLoader()); return worker; }, ($, exception) -> { if (!(exception instanceof InterruptedException) && !(exception instanceof CancellationException) && !(exception instanceof ThreadDeath)) { |
